FP&A Senior Manager

Remote, US

Finvisor is a startup-focused, full-service firm that performs accounting, AP/AR, compliance, payroll, forecasting, CFO, and controller services. Our team supports the fastest growing and most exciting startups in the U.S. and around the world. We manage our clients’ financial operations so they can focus on growing their product and business.

Location: Remote | Department: FP&A
Reports to: CEO

Salary: $130-$145k Base, depending on experience + 10-20% OTE bonus

About the Role:

We’re seeking a dynamic and experienced FP&A Senior Manager to serve as a client-facing fractional advisor for a portfolio of high-growth, venture-backed startups. This role is 100% externally focused—you will work directly with founders, executive teams, and boards to drive financial planning, strategy, and reporting.

As a strategic advisor, you will guide clients through complex financial decisions, lead forecasting efforts, and support investor communications. This role is perfect for a high-performing finance leader who thrives in a fast-paced, client-centric environ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the primary financial advisor to a portfolio of startup clients.

  • Own financial planning, budgeting, forecasting, and performance analysis across revenue, expenses, and cash flow for each client.

  • Lead the creation and delivery of Board-ready reporting packages, investor updates, and strategic analysis.

  • Build and maintain driver-based financial models tailored to SaaS, fintech, and other startup verticals.

  • Collaborate directly with client founders and executives to align financial strategy with business goals.

  • Support fundraising efforts by preparing financial projections and materials for investors.

  • Identify and monitor key business drivers that impact client financial outcomes.

  • Provide insights into customer acquisition, operational efficiency, and cash runway management.

  • Present strategic recommendations to client stakeholders and Boards in a compelling, data-driven way.

  • Serve as a liaison between clients and Finvisor’s internal teams to ensure cohesive execution.

Qualifications:

  • 5–10 years of experience in FP&A, corporate finance, consulting, or a similar client-facing role.

  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, or a related field (MBA or Master’s a plus).

  • Proven experience supporting VC-backed startups in Finance or FP&A capacity.

  • Deep expertise in financial modeling, forecasting, and business performance analysis.

  • Exceptional communication and presentation skills; comfortable engaging with founders and Boards.

  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ple clients and deliver high-quality results under tight deadlines.

  • Strong working knowledge of Excel/Google Sheets; experience with systems like NetSuite, Salesforce, and planning tools is a plus.

  • High EQ and professionalism in client communication; able to build trust quickly and influence strategic decisions.
